Deuteronomy 1:41-44
New King James Version
41 “Then you answered and said to me, (A)‘We have sinned against the Lord; we will go up and fight, just as the Lord our God commanded us.’ And when everyone of you had girded on his weapons of war, you were ready to go up into the mountain.
42 “And the Lord said to me, ‘Tell them, (B)“Do not go up nor fight, for I am not among you; lest you be defeated before your enemies.” ’ 43 So I spoke to you; yet you would not listen, but (C)rebelled against the command of the Lord, and (D)presumptuously[a] went up into the mountain. 44 And the Amorites who dwelt in that mountain came out against you and chased you (E)as bees do, and drove you back from Seir to Hormah.

Deuteronomy 1:41-44
English Standard Version
41 “Then you answered me, (A)‘We have sinned against the Lord. We ourselves will go up and fight, just as the Lord our God commanded us.’ And every one of you fastened on his weapons of war and thought it easy to go up into the hill country. 42 And the Lord said to me, (B)‘Say to them, Do not go up or fight, (C)for I am not in your midst, lest you be defeated before your enemies.’ 43 So I spoke to you, and you would not listen; but you rebelled against the command of the Lord and (D)presumptuously went up into the hill country. 44 (E)Then the Amorites who lived in that hill country came out against you and chased you (F)as bees do and beat you down in Seir as far as (G)Hormah.
